  Northern Ireland Social Attitudes Survey - 1990

Year: 1990

Module: Public_Spending
Variable: FALSECLM


Question:
I will read two statements. For each one please say whether you agree or disagree? Strongly or slightly?
Large numbers of people these days falsely claim benefits.

Overall Results %
Agree strongly43
Agree slightly23
Disagree slightly14
Disagree strongly12
Don't know8
